Types of Ovens

Ovens are available in different types, dealing with various cooking requirements and choices. Here's a breakdown of the most typical types of ovens you'll find for sale today:

Type of OvenDescriptionPerfect For
Conventional OvenUses convected heat to cook food uniformly from all sides.General baking and roasting
Convection OvenUtilizes a fan to distribute hot air, supplying even cooking and decreasing cooking time.Baking and complicated dishes
Microwave OvenCooks food using electro-magnetic radiation; excellent for reheating and thawing.Quick meals and snacks
Wall OvenDeveloped into the wall, saving flooring area while offering a sleek appearance.Space-saving kitchen area styles
Steam OvenCooks food using steam, retaining wetness and nutrients.Healthy cooking and baking
Air Fryer OvenCombination of an air fryer and oven; flows hot air for a crispy surface.Healthy frying choices

Kinds of Hobs

Just like ovens, hobs (or cooktops) come in a number of styles, each with its own set of benefits. Below is a contrast of the various kinds of hobs readily available:

Type of HobDescriptionSuitable For
Gas HobUses gas burners for instant heat; great for accurate temperature control.Traditional cooking
Electric HobUses electrical coils or smooth glass surfaces; good for easy cleaning.Hassle-free daily cooking
Induction HobUtilizes electromagnetic energy to heat pots directly, providing fast heat.Quick and effective cooking
Ceramic HobSimilar to electrical hobs however with a smooth glass surface area, providing modern looks.Aesthetic kitchens
Portable HobCompact and quickly transportable; normally electric or induction.Limited area cooking

Functions to Consider

When picking ovens and hobs to acquire, there are numerous crucial features to think about:

Ovens

  1. Size and Capacity: Ensure the oven fits your kitchen area space and meets your cooking volume needs.
  2. Energy Efficiency: Look for ovens with high energy ratings to minimize electrical energy expenses.
  3. Self-cleaning Options: Ovens with self-cleaning features can conserve time and effort.
  4. Smart Technology: Modern ovens might consist of Wi-Fi connection, allowing for remote operation and monitoring.
  5. Multiple Cooking Modes: Look for ovens with versatile cooking modes such as baking, broiling, and roasting.

Hobs

  1. Heat Control: The ability to adjust temperature rapidly is vital, particularly for gas and induction hobs.
  2. Security Features: Look for automatic shut-off, kid locks, and other security steps.
  3. Ease of Cleaning: Smooth surface areas are simpler to clean than traditional grills.
  4. Power Levels: Hobs with adjustable power levels enable much better control over cooking.
  5. Installation Requirements: Ensure you comprehend the installation process, particularly for gas hobs which require appropriate ventilation.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ION

1. What is the difference between a convection and a conventional oven?

A convection oven includes a fan that flows air for even cooking, while a conventional oven relies entirely on convected heat.

2. Are induction hobs safe?

Yes, induction hobs are generally safe as they only heat up when suitable pots and pans is put on them, reducing the danger of burns.

3. How typically should I clean my oven?

It's advisable to clean the oven every couple of months, or more regularly if utilized heavily, to maintain its effectiveness and health.

4. Can I set up a gas hob myself?

While it is possible, it is suggested to have an expert set up gas hobs for safety reasons.

5. What is the typical life expectancy of an oven or hob?

Normally, ovens and hobs can last anywhere from 10 to 15 years, depending upon usage and maintenance.
